ZeroCount posted:kinda weird that they felt legacy was a less healthy format than the current standard That's looking at it backwards. The question they asked was which format would the improvement from a change outweigh the disadvantages. That was clearly true for legacy and less so for standard.

mandatory lesbian posted:i think I'm gonna draft tonight, I missed the pre-release so tell me, in the all of a week this set has been draftable, anything standing out as good. This question is so ridiculously open ended, draft is self correcting, and it will all depend on your seat and the pack particulars of that one event, so, yes. A good draft deck will be good. Generally I think all the archetypes can get there. RB and RW beats & tricks. UW UG Tempo, UB cycling, BG Counters. Haven't seen much BW.
